**Job Summary** The successful applicant will have an opportunity to contribute to a wide variety of interesting water resources projects that include stormwater and watershed management, hydrology, hydraulics, stream rehabilitation, in\-field assessments and monitoring\. Skills you will likely use or develop in this job include hydraulic and hydrologic modelling, field site inspection, surveying, water quality and quantity monitoring, data analysis, and report writing and assembly in a friendly, fast\-paced consulting engineering work environment at AECOM in London\.
Responsibilities for this position include but are not limited to:
+ Working directly with group manager and project managers on projects related to Water Resources, with an emphasis on transportation projects
+ Will be responsible for projects including communicating with client, meetings, completing technical analysis, preparing reports, designs in support of the senior WR staff and cross business line project managers
**Minimum Requirements**
+ Bachelors degree in Engineering or related field
+ Strong capability to develop and apply various water resources modeling programs e\.g\. HEC\-RAS, SWMM, SWMHYMO, VISUAL OTTHYMO etc\.
+ Ability to learn quickly, communicate effectively and work with others is essential
+ Registered with PEO and working toward designation as a Professional Engineer with the PEO
+ Strong computer skills including advanced working knowledge of Word and Excel
+ Must possess excellent organizational, communication and writing skills
+ Valid driver’s license and access to a vehicle
**Preferred Qualifications**
+ Design and construction experience related to transportation infrastructure, stormwater and/or erosion and slope stability projects
+ Experience including preparation of cost estimates and tender packages as well as contract administration
